Victims identified in fatal Bowie Middle School car crash

28-year-old Adan Olivas Hidalgo of Mexico and 41-year-old Maria Belmares Martinez of Idalou, TX. died in the crash.

ODESSA, Texas — NewsWest 9 is learning who died in the fatal Bowie Middle School car crash on Friday, July 12. 28-year-old Adan Olivas Hidalgo of Mexico and 41-year-old Maria Belmares Martinez of Idalou, TX. died in the crash, according to the Odessa Police Department.

According to a media release, at 11:30 p.m., OPD responded to 22nd St. and Golder Ave. because of a major crash.

Once officers arrived and conducted an investigation, the investigation revealed that a black Nissan Altima was going eastbound in the 600 block of W. 22nd St. at a high rate of speed. That is when Hidalgo lost control and crashed into a street sign and north fence of Bowie Middle School. The car continued through the fence and hit the west side of Bowie.

Next of kin have not been notified for Hidalgo and Martinez.

According to OPD, speed and alcohol are believed to be factors in the fatal crash.

An investigation is ongoing.
